What is custom embroidery?

Custom embroidery is the process of decorating fabric or other materials with needle and thread, creating personalized or unique designs, logos, or text. This technique is commonly used to add branding to uniforms, personalize gifts, and embellish apparel like hats, shirts, and jackets. Custom embroidery can be done by hand or with specialized embroidery machines, allowing for intricate and durable designs. It is valued for its professional appearance and long-lasting results.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a custom embroidery specialist?

To excel as a Custom Embroidery Specialist, you need expertise in textile techniques, attention to detail, and often formal training in design or garment production. Familiarity with embroidery machines, digitizing software, and relevant design tools like Adobe Illustrator or CorelDRAW is crucial. Creativity, patience, and strong communication skills help you interpret client needs and deliver high-quality results. These skills ensure precise, attractive embroidery work that meets customer specifications and maintains high standards of craftsmanship.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als in custom embroidery roles, and how can they be managed?

Professionals in custom embroidery often face challenges such as tight deadlines, maintaining consistent quality across large orders, and adapting to a variety of fabric types and customer specifications. Managing these challenges typically involves str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and effective communication with clients and team members. Staying updated with the latest embroidery technologies and regularly maintaining equipment also helps ensure smooth workflow and high-quality results.

What is the difference between Custom Embroidery vs Embroidery Machine Operator?

AspectCustom EmbroideryEmbroidery Machine Operator
CredentialsDesign skills, embroidery software knowledgeMachine operation certifications, technical skills
Work EnvironmentDesign studios, print shops, custom shopsManufacturing facilities, production lines
Industry UsageCreating custom designs, personalized itemsRunning embroidery machines for mass or custom production

Custom Embroidery involves designing and creating personalized embroidery patterns, often requiring artistic skills and software knowledge. Embroidery Machine Operators focus on operating and maintaining embroidery machines to produce embroidered products. While both roles work within the embroidery industry, Custom Embroidery emphasizes design and customization, whereas Embroidery Machine Operators concentrate on machine operation and production efficiency.

About World Emblem International

World Emblem is a global leader in high-quality apparel decorations. Our diverse product line includes FlexStyle, custom embroidery, sublimated patches, high-visibility striping, and transfers. We pride ourselves on industry-leading turnaround times—averaging less than five days—and a commitment to innovation. At World Emblem, we foster an inspiring work environment where team members have the resources to grow and succeed.


Job Summary

We are looking for detail-oriented Machine Operators / Sewers to join our growing production team. In this role, you will be responsible for operating industrial embroidery and sewing machinery to create high-quality products.

Experience in embroidery or manufacturing is a plus, but not required—we provide comprehensive training for the right candidates.

Key Responsibilities
  • Set up and operate multi-head embroidery or sewing machines.

  • Monitor production runs to ensure consistent quality and output.

  • Perform basic machine maintenance, such as threading needles and adjusting tensions.

  • Identify and correct garment or stitching defects during the production process.

Required Skills & Abilities
  • Visual Precision: Ability to identify colors and detect subtle differences in patterns, letters, and numbers.

  • Manual Dexterity: Strong hand-eye coordination to quickly thread needles and manipulate small objects.

  • Technical Control: Ability to make repeated, precise adjustments to machine controls.

  • Pace: Comfort working in a high-volume, fast-paced manufacturing environment.
